The wonderful world of wiggly worms!

Bug took on a fun adventure at the Dawes Arboretum in Newark, Ohio. They offered a wonderful worm program that was fun and very hands on! The program started off explaining how useful worms are to us by turning decay into soil. What great recyclers! The children were able to pick out worms and view them with magnifying glasses and microscopes. Then came the icky gooey part!! Bug then went digging in the soil for worms!
